Ticket Strategy
First off, determine your raffle ticket sales strategy. In many cases, these types of "raffles" will tend to have a single ticket purchase as well as a multiple ticket option.
More tickets per dollar may provide your guests with a perceived value and give them more chances at winning while fewer tickets per dollar (and still priced at easy to buy points) will allow all guests to easily take part in the raffle. With either option, selling single tickets or selling multiple tickets, both offer your guests more ways to help you make your fundraiser successful.

In-Person Paper Raffle Tickets
Although Auctria can help you with tracking the sale of the "raffle tickets", you will still likely need to use some sort of paper raffle tickets for your "in-person" guests to claim their prize.
Paper tickets are often small, relatively inexpensive, and usually have pre-printed numbers allowing you to separate them and put one in the ticket draw box and give the other to your guest.
An example of a common roll of "paper tickets" that might be used.
Guests would purchase their raffle tickets through Auctria and get an appropriate amount of paper tickets representing the number of lots they purchased.
IMPORTANT
IMPORTANT You will still have to track which guest received which ticket(s) although this is still easy to manage and use to identify the winners. You can use a paper and pen log book or some sort of digital means such as a spreadsheet.
Although Auctria does not provide a "drawing" mechanism, the idea of a "blind draw" by a keynote speaker or other important person -- or randomly picked guest -- during the event could help generate more interest and excitement to build on.
This could even serve as an intermission-style break during an in-person event.
Virtual 50-50 Raffle
The premise of a Virtual 50-50 Raffle may be challenging although it is still something that might be considered. Since there is no "in-person" component you will need to be able to sort out how to choose a winner "virtually". This could be an opportunity to use the Export Individual Sales feature set available with For Sale items.
Export Individual Sales
As a special case, For Sale Items have an additional Activity related option under Exporting & Printing (in the sidebar) allowing you to Export Individual Sales for the specific item as an XLS formatted file.
Clicking the button will immediately start the process and download the file in your browser.
INFORMATION
Using the Export Individual Sales on a Raffle Ticket item will provide you with a list of buyers of that item. This list might be further reviewed and could potentially be used in a raffle "drawing" external to Auctria.
